Speaker expounds Colossians 4:2-6. He shows that non-believers can be sensitive, but that they must accept Christ. He thus argues that we must not view non-believers judgementally, or it will turn people away. Speaker shows that we need to pray for opportunities to share Christ, and that God will give us the words to speak. He examines how we communicate the gospel.
